Childhood Toys

Now that evokes wonderful childhood memories of my adorable Li'l Snoopy dog and here he is...


I received the CJ 'Childhood Toys' a while ago and knew once the theme had been chosen who I would be using.
I loved this dog, much to the despair and delight of my poor Mom especially when he accompanied us on a supermarket trip! What makes Snoopy special, well its his feet because when you pull him they go round and make the best (or bestest which I would often say as a little girl) clickety clack sound you've ever heard.
If that wasn't enough, if I walked extremely fast I could make his springy tail wobble and smack his bottom which just added to my total enjoyment of taking Snoopy for a walk.

Now they don't make toys like him anymore, such a shame we've become a horrid plastic nation :( Bring back Snoopy I say.
I've scrapped him using Basic Grey patterned papers which are cute in their own right and added some retro flowers as the owner did not want any journalling in her CJ.
